I've had mine mounted on the firewall since I got it and autocrossed with two different organizations and never had an issue. Maybe it's a dragstrip/road course issue. Aside from the super serious autocross organizations I doubt anyone would reallly give you trouble with it. Most of the time they are making sure the car is fit to drive the course. Brakes are working, no leaks, etc.
I really like that bracket. Next time I'm out messing with the car I'll see if there's room for me to mount it there. I made a mount out of stainless sheet that sits towards the passenger side of the hood latch and just did a quick cut and bend job. It serves the purpose but isn't pretty. In fact aside from the grease, I'd say it's the ugliest thing under my hood.
